From WordNet (r) 3.0 (2006) :

  branch out
      v 1: vary in order to spread risk or to expand; "The company
           diversified" [syn: diversify, branch out, broaden]
           [ant: narrow, narrow down, specialise, specialize]

From Moby Thesaurus II by Grady Ward, 1.0 :

  54 Moby Thesaurus words for "branch out":
     bestrew, bifurcate, branch, broadcast, circumfuse, deal out,
     deploy, diffract, diffuse, dispense, disperse, dispread,
     disseminate, distribute, divaricate, diverge, expand, extend, fan,
     fan out, flare, fork, furcate, issue, open, open up, outspread,
     outstretch, overgrow, overrun, overscatter, oversow, overspread,
     propagate, publish, radiate, ramify, retail, scatter, sow,
     sow broadcast, splay, spraddle, sprangle, sprawl, spread,
     spread like wildfire, spread out, stem, strew, trifurcate, unfold,
     utter, widen

